    I Can't Believe Wings Fans Are Booing Hossa

    It doesn't matter to me one iota what fans do or don't do with regards to booing, but as long as I'm here: Well, considering he spurned long-term deals to ink a one year contract on a great team to get HIMSELF a Cup he probably was giving it his all when it came down to the very end. He wasn't particularly good, but he was hurt -- he's pretty unfairly vilified for that. He turned down some like $90M contract from Edmonton to take the deal with Detroit. He ended up losing a lot of money out of the gambit considering what he's going to make in Chicago, and there was a lot of talk about how that would be the case so he was aware of it when he did it.
